Comprehending Guttering
Guttering is a system developed to redirect rainwater far from roofs, reducing the danger of leaks and water-related damage to structures. By transporting the water safely to storm drains pipes or other drainage systems, guttering protects foundations, walls, and landscaping.
Types of Guttering
There are a number of types of gutters readily available, each offering various advantages:
K-style Gutters:
Popular for houses.Include a flat bottom and a decorative front.Readily available in various products, including vinyl, aluminum, and copper.
Half-round Gutters:
Semicircular fit, making them a visually pleasing option.Typically seen in historic homes.Direct water circulation effectively however might need more maintenance.
Box Gutters:
Rectangular and constructed into the roof's structure.Developed to manage heavy rainfall.Best for commercial structures.
Seamless Gutters:
Custom-made from a single piece of product.Decrease leaks and improve durability.Require professional installation but are worth the financial investment.Importance of Local Guttering Systems

Key Components of Local Guttering
Understanding the components of a guttering system is important for appropriate maintenance and functionality.
Elements:
Gutter Hooks/Brackets: Hold gutters in place and must be set up correctly to avoid drooping.
Downspouts: Direct water from the gutters down to the ground or drainage system.
End Caps: Seal completions of gutters, avoiding leakages.
Gutter Guards: Prevent leaves and particles from accumulating, decreasing the requirement for frequent cleaning.
Elbows: Connect straight sections of downspouts for directional modifications.
Maintenance of Local Guttering Systems
Routine maintenance of gutter systems is vital to ensure effective water circulation. Disregarding gutter maintenance can lead to blockages, overflows, and serious damage. Here are some important maintenance pointers:
Regular Cleaning: Clean gutters at least twice a year, especially in the spring and fall. Eliminate leaves, twigs, and debris that can block the flow of water.
Look for Leaks and Rust: Inspect for any signs of leakages or rust, especially in metal gutters. Seal any leaks promptly with suitable sealants.
Check Hangers and Brackets: Ensure that all brackets and wall mounts are safely connected. Replace any broken parts to maintain the stability of the gutter system.
See for Pests: Ensure that gutters are devoid of nests that could block water circulation.
Assess the Drainage System: Make sure that downspouts direct water a minimum of three feet far from the structure of the building.
FAQs about Local Guttering
Q: How typically should I clean my gutters?A: It is suggested to clean your gutters at least twice a year, preferably in the spring and fall. In addition, if you have many trees near your home, you may need to clean them regularly.
Q: What are the indications that my gutters need repair or replacement?A: Look for sagging or retreating from your home, rust areas, leakages or cracks, extreme water build-up around the foundation, peeling paint on the outside of your home, or mold development inside.
Q: Can I install gutters myself?A: While DIY installation is possible, it is suggested to seek advice from with a professional. Incorrect installation can lead to improper drainage and further concerns.
Q: What materials are best for gutters?A: The best product for your gutters depends on your budget, aesthetic preferences, and climate. Aluminum and vinyl are popular for their sturdiness and low maintenance, while copper is preferred for its elegance however comes at a greater expense.
Q: How do gutter guards work?A: Gutter guards are developed to filter out debris while enabling water to stream easily, minimizing the need for cleaning and maintenance.
